Skylights are a fantastic way to bring natural light into your home and enhance its aesthetic appeal. They can also increase energy efficiency and ventilation. However, when it comes to choosing between opening and non-opening skylights, non-opening ones are often the better choice. Here's why:
-
Reduced risk of leaks: One of the biggest advantages of non-opening skylights is that they have fewer components, which means fewer opportunities for water to seep through. When you opt for an opening skylight, you have to take into consideration the fact that they have hinges and seals that can wear down over time, increasing the risk of leaks.
-
Better energy efficiency: Non-opening skylights are much better at keeping heat in during the winter and out during the summer. They have fewer gaps and a tighter seal than opening skylights, which can result in significant savings on your energy bills.
-
Lower maintenance: As mentioned earlier, non-opening skylights have fewer components, which means that there are fewer parts that need to be maintained and replaced. This can save you time and money in the long run.
-
Improved safety: Non-opening skylights are safer for households with children and pets. You won't have to worry about someone accidentally leaving the skylight open or falling through it.
-
Greater design flexibility: Non-opening skylights come in a wider range of shapes and sizes than opening ones. This can provide more options for incorporating natural light into your home's design.
